Severe Thunderstorm Warning
National Weather Service Lubbock TX
1114 PM CDT Sat May 23 2026

The National Weather Service in Lubbock Texas has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
  Floyd County in northwestern Texas...
  Motley County in northwestern Texas...
  Southern Hall County in the Panhandle of Texas...
  Southeastern Briscoe County in the Panhandle of Texas...

* Until midnight CDT.

* At 1113 PM CD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line
  extending from 6 miles north of Caprock Canyon State Park to 7
  miles west of Flomot to 3 miles east of Lockney, moving east at 45
  mph.

  HAZARD...70 mph wind gusts and nickel size hail.

  SOURCE...West Texas Mesonet. At 1109 PM CDT, a wind gust of 66 mph 
           was measured by the mesonet near Silverton.

  IMPACT...Expect considerable tree damage. Damage is likely to 
           mobile homes, roofs, and outbuildings.

* Locations impacted include...
  Floydada, Matador, Turkey, Caprock Canyon State Park, Lockney,
  Quitaque, Valley Schools, Flomot, South Plains, Dougherty,
  Northfield, and Roaring Springs.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.

Torrential rainfall is occurring with these storms, and may lead to
flash fl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ways.
